We are not struggling with relationships…
we are struggling with understanding. 💭

Had the privilege of facilitating a beautiful, honest, and deeply engaging workshop:

✨ Lost in Translation: Decoding Relationships ✨

A room full of people…
but more importantly — a room full of real conversations.

💡 One powerful reminder from the session:

Sometimes, it’s not what we say…
it’s how it is heard.

A small shift like:

“Help me understand…”
instead of
“Why are you doing this?”

…can change everything.

❤️ We laughed
🤝 We reflected
🌱 We connected

And maybe… just maybe…
we all left with a little more understanding than we came with.

When organisations choose conversations that are uncomfortable, they also choose growth.
And that’s exactly what Real Leadership looks like.

Recently, I had the opportunity to design and deliver a large-scale workshop for Palo Alto Networks on the theme: “Men as Allies: Creating the ‘We’ Culture.”

This is not a conventional topic. And that’s precisely why it matters.

I deeply admire organisations like Palo Alto Networks that have the foresight and courage to move beyond surface-level inclusion—and invest in conversations that reshape culture at its core.

The workshop was delivered in a hybrid format—live in Bangalore, with participants joining virtually from across India. What stood out was the level of engagement: highly interactive, reflective, and participative across both formats.

Together, we explored:
• Moving from passive support to Active Allyship
• Building psychological safety through shared ownership, not gendered responsibility
• Leveraging emotional intelligence and confidence as collective leadership assets
• Creating a “We Culture” where inclusion is not an initiative—but a lived experience

At the core of the session was a framework I designed on: ‘With Great Power, Comes Great Responsibility’. We often carry the idea that Heroes must be responsible but we seldom remember that a responsible individual carries heroism within her/him.
